我目前正在尝试使用R中的plotly创建交互式3D曲面图。我的数据集包含纬度和经度矩阵,我有一个DEM用于我想要制作此曲面图的区域。但是,我无法做同样的事情。
以下是我的尝试:
Points_new <- data.frame(Points.sp$Long, Points.sp$Lat, Points.sp$Elevation)
Points_new <- as.matrix(Points_new)
p <- plot_ly(z = ~Points_new) %>% add_surface()
p
http://php.net/manual/en/language.operators.comparison.php
在上面的图中,我手动加载了每个点的高程值,但问题是我需要在区域的DEM上使用这些点,每次我尝试加载DEM时,都会收到错误说 - &#39; z&#39;必须是数字矩阵。
这里的DEM是该地区的栅格。
有什么建议吗?理想情况下,我希望DEM上的点为小圆圈。